Annual Survival golf tournament tees off this weekend

All golfers are hereby notified that the highly anticipated annual Survival golf tournament returns this weekend, and two days of thrilling competition are promised on March 2nd and 3rd.
Players have the unique opportunity to choose their preferred day of play, thereby ensuring maximum participation and flexibility.
This tournament, which would be hosted at the Lusignan Golf Club, would feature Medal play over 18 holes, with competitors divided into two flights based on handicap: 0-13 and 14-28. A plethora of prestigious prizes awaits, including:

● 1st Place Trophy (Overall Best Net Winner)
● 1st Place Trophy (0-13 Handicap)
● 1st Place Trophy (14-28 Handicap)
● Longest Drive Trophy
● Nearest to Pin Trophy
● Consolation Prizes for 2nd to 4th place in each flight

LGC Vice President Brian Hackett, standing alongside LGC President Patanjilee Persaud, receiving the sponsorship cheque from a Survival representative

Tee times are set for 8:00am sharp on both Saturday and Sunday, ensuring an early start to the excitement. In adherence to Covid-19 safety protocols, all participants are reminded to observe necessary practices throughout the event.
Players are being advised to kindly connect with the club’s manager on the day of the tournament to collect scorecards, settle tournament fees, and proceed to their allocated tee boxes promptly for the 8:00am tee-off.
Mark your calendars for the prize giving ceremony, scheduled for 1:30pm on Sunday, when champions would be celebrated and accolades presented.
